Steve Hilton, who is running for governor of California, told reporters on Monday that if he can finish top two in the gubernatorial primary, he can turn the Golden State red.
Tuesday’s primary will see the top two vote-getters advance to the general election regardless of party.
“Most of the polls are showing me either leading or in the second slot,” Hilton, one of two leading Republican candidates, said. “There was that one poll that showed me third. And frankly, I’m behaving as if I’m third.”
“I’m telling all my supporters to assume that that’s the poll,” Hilton added. “Because we can’t let this slip away. It does look good. It looks like we’re going to get into the top two.”
Hilton said he knows he will be able to win in the blue state that hasn’t elected a Republican to the governor’s office since Arnold Schwarzenegger.
“In a recent poll, 56% of Californians said that [the] state’s going in the wrong direction,” Hilton said. “There’s a majority for change in California. You’re seeing the energy behind my campaign. We are done with these Democrats, but it’s not going to happen unless people vote.”
“I’m the only candidate that’s able to get in the top two that’s going to bring about change,” Hilton added.
Hilton has been attempting to consolidate support among Republicans, even though Riverside County Sheriff Chad Bianco remains in the race.
Hilton said that if enough people go for Bianco, it could put two Democrats in the top two.
“I’ve been very clear to Chad personally,” Hilton said. “I have the utmost respect for him and for his supporters, but we’ve had a year now. We’ve had the debates. It’s now just about the math.”
“And the math is very clear. I’m afraid he doesn’t have the possibility of getting in the top two,” Hilton added. “So every vote for Chad is actually a vote that makes it more likely we’ll end up with two Democrats.”
